Light-Haven Home Inc. is a charitable organization based in Bruce Mines, Ontario, classified by the CRA under organizations relieving poverty.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2024, it reported $636K in revenue and $706K in expenditures. Spending exceeded revenue that year — the gap came out of reserves.
In 2024, 6 other registered charities reported granting it a combined $18K.
Compared with 2,470 poverty-relief char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 64% of peers. None of its ten highest-paid positions cleared $40,000. The charity reported 6 permanent full-time positions.
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 10 names.
